Description
Two set of trail lines are seen on this dual directional trail die. The first and strongest set has trail lines (with black arrows) from the left side letters in EPU, The first S in STATES the word UNITED the left corner of the cornice the top left corners of the left side columns, the left corners of the stylobate and the N and E of ONE. The offset direction for this set of trails is 320 degrees. The second and weaker set has trail lines (with white arrows) from the MERI of AMERICA, the right corner of the roof, the right corner of the cornice, the right corners of the stylobate, the designer’s initials and the word CENT. The offset direction of this set is 080 degrees.
Die Markers
- Stage “B “, obverse is LMDS – a die gouge is seen under the G of GOD.
- Reverse is LMDS – a small die gouge is seen in the upper part of bay 11.
